DescriptionAll data is stored inside objects which are linked by so-called link attributes. Objects consist of classes which can be extended and de-extended at runtime. Graphs can be defined with a struct.An enterprise-class RDBMS compatible with PostgreSQL and Oracle and widely used in China.A high performance, scalable Wide Column DBMSObject-relational database and reports server
